Did J.K. Rowling consider killing Harry?

Did J.K. Rowling consider killing Harry?

Harry Potter Yes, at one point JK Rowling really did consider killing off the Boy Who Lived. Fortunately she decided against it, despite saying that his death would have meant a “neater ending” for the series. In a 2007 Dateline interview, she explained: “It was felt to be a possibility that the hero would die.

Did George Weasley get married?

Sometime after the end of the Second Wizarding war, George married Angelina Johnson, with whom he had a son named Fred, in honour of his late twin, and a daughter named Roxanne. He and his brother Ron also turned Weasleys’ Wizard Wheezes into a huge money spinner.

Why did JK Rowling kill off Fortescue?

Because originally, Fortescue was intended to be more connected to the Deathly Hallows, but the plot strand got snipped. During the book, we do see Fortescue mysteriously disappear – but while Rowling originally meant for Harry to discover him, she ended up having to kill him off for no reason.

Why did JK Rowling choose Fred and George?

Rowling has since described Fred’s death as ‘the worst for me’. Incidentally, Fred was chosen to die over his twin George because he was the slightly more conspicuous brother. ‘Fred is normally the funnier but also the crueller of the two.
